I attended a seminar in October 2001 and purchased a reseller package for $99 a executive package $3000 (put money down and finaced the rest at $103.03 for 36 months) and a epenzio merchant account for 36 payments of $89.95.

I have cancelled all but the executive and as of today's date 4/12/2003 I have paid in a total of $3537.84. I have the Missouri Attorney General involed as well as just recently sent the information to the Utah Attorney General's office (that is where this company is located.)

At the seminar they show you how to do everything and explain it as a do it yourself program. With this in mind it should be something you can do by yourself, at this point in the seminar it really peaked my interest eventhough at the time I didn't own a computer.

At the seminar and via U S Mail they say you get a computer for free. (This is with approved credit only for the internet access.) Didn't qualify for the computer imagine that. Next step that I took after the seminar is to buy a computer.

Did that and guess what the software didn't work and I assumed maybe my computer didn't have the necessary stats that the book explained. My family had the intentions on building me a computer for christmas that year anyway and with that in mind.

I figured if I would have that kind of money rolling in soon, what would it hurt if I kept it so I continued paying all fees associated with these companies. I called to find out what companies would be taking money and when for financial planning of all my bills.

My family did not give me the computer til after christmas sometime. I tried once I did receive the computer to my amazement it didn't work still.

At this point I am very upset and call the company and they were no help except for explaining that I needed to purchase more software or something. I basically explain to them that finacially that isn't possible.

I then proceed to ask for a refund about February of 2002. At this time they tell me the only way I could get my money back is if I sell my materials to someone else. So I tell people about this stuff and I couldn't really explain and sell them the product if it doesn't work how they explain at the seminar.

So I send emails, letters and make phone calls and cancel with a $300 cancellation fee for the epenzio(merchant account). Was able to cancel everything else except the executive package. When I cancelled the reseller package and requested a refund via the website it informed me to send all reseller materials back.

I sent the CD, BOOK AND OTHER CD(QUESTIONS AND ANSWER). Also sent in Store Builder Kit. I never received the executive package (15 websites). I have tried and tried to close this situation with Bring It Home, Inc. and I keep getting the same response from Mr. Brad Crawford. I am sure others have had the same response, "I am sorry that (your name here) feels there is a problem with (whatever your problem is) that he/she purchased from (whatever company name they used) and we stand willing and able to help."

It seems to get them out of the blue for a while, but we need to stop them. I just don't understand how a company can legally get by with this as us consumers lose more and more money by companies like this.

All I want is to get my money back and warn other individuals out there that have been contacted by this and other companies. ANY HELP PLEASE POST SO ALL CAN SEE. THANKS

They filed CHAPTER 11 BANKRUPTCY on 09/05/2003 under the name AVALON DIGITAL MARKETING SYSTEMS with the address of 5255 N. Edgewood Drive, Suite 250, Provo, UT 84604. Case # 03-35180 GEC. Taxpayer Id # 77-0511097. Attorney for them is Penrod W. Keith Of DURHAM JONES AND PINEGAR, his address is 111 East Broadway, Suite 900, Salt Lake City, UT 84111. His Telephone # (801) 415-3000. Address for the Bankruptcy Clerks Office: 350 South Main #301, Salt Lake City, UT 84101. Telephone # (801) 524-6687. The Bankruptcy Clerks Hours 8am - 4:30pm telphone hours 9am-4pm. Proof of Claim must be received by the bankruptcy clerks office by 03/05/2004.

As of 06/01/2003 I stopped payments for the Executive package that they moved the financing to Monteray Financial Services. As of the 06/01/2003 I have paid in $3743.90. If I would have continued paying they would have gotten about $1700 additional out of me before it was paid off bringing my total well over $5000.00 which as stated I Sent the Reseller package that was $99 (included a CD, A BOOK AND ANOTHER CD WITH Q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S ON IT). The financing was for the Executive package (15 WEBSITES) of which I NEVER RECEIVED.
